Tim,

thanks for that information. I had a look at the xnu source - you are right. The constraint won't prevent a real-time thread from starving non-realtime threads.

Julian

On Tue, May 31, 2016 at 9:51 PM, Tim Hewett <email@hidden> wrote:
Julian,

The constraints parameters were ignored in the kernel for many generations of OS X in spite of the documentation defining their use. The real documentation (the source code) said otherwise.

I am not sure if they are still ignored, IIRC the kernel-side code is not hard to find to check.

Tim.


On 31 May 2016, at 20:00, email@hidden wrote:

> Hi,
>
> I'm trying to create real-time threads via the
> THREAD_TIME_CONSTRAINT_POLICY.
> It works fine, an interrupt after each computation cycle can be seen inside
> the profiler (Instruments / System Trace) but the constraint seems to be
> ignored.
>
> I would expect a penalty after the constraint time is over but the thread
> stays on the CPU starving other threads.
>
> That's the way I initialize the time constraint policy:
>
>    thread_time_constraint_policy_data_t time_constraints;
>
>    time_constraints.period = (int) NanosecondsToAbsolute (1000000); // 1
> ms
>
>    time_constraints.computation = (int) NanosecondsToAbsolute (250000); //
> 0.25 ms
>
>    time_constraints.constraint = (int) NanosecondsToAbsolute(500000); //
> 0.5 ms
>
>    time_constraints.preemptible = 1;
>
>    thread_policy_set(mach_thread_self (), THREAD_TIME_CONSTRAINT_POLICY,
> (thread_policy_t) &time_constraints, THREAD_TIME_CONSTRAINT_POLICY_COUNT);
>
> Any ideas how to get the constraint working?
>
> Regards,
> Julian
